History Of Phantom On Broadway

Phantom of the Opera on Broadway first opened in 1988, quickly becoming one of the longest-running musicals in theater history. Its debut at the Majestic Theatre established a new benchmark for production values, elaborate sets, and powerful vocal performances.

Over the decades, the show has maintained its presence, adapting to new audience expectations while preserving the core spectacle that made it an immediate classic.

Venue Details And Location

The production is housed at the Majestic Theatre, a celebrated landmark that contributes to the theatrical atmosphere even before the curtain rises. The theater’s ornate architecture complements the operatic grandeur of the show.

Located in the heart of the Theater District, the venue is accessible by public transportation and surrounded by a variety of dining and hospitality options, making it convenient for both tourists and locals.

Where can I buy tickets for Phantom of the Opera on Broadway?

Purchase tickets through the official Majestic Theatre box office or authorized online sellers to ensure authenticity and avoid inflated resale prices.

Is the show suitable for children?

Yes, families often attend together, though some darker themes and intense scenes may be more suitable for older children and teenagers.

How long is the performance, including intermission?

The show typically runs around two hours and thirty minutes, including a fifteen-minute intermission.
